Wonderful WABARA Roses from Japan
WABARA Roses What does WABARA mean? The roses bred by the people from the Keiji rose farm call the roses ‘WABARA’. Wa (å’Œ ?) is a Japanese cultural concept usually translated into English as “harmony”. It implies a peaceful unity and conformity within a social group, in which members prefer the continuation of a harmonious […]

Three new David Austin Wedding Roses for 2019
Already introduced at the exhibition at this year’s IPM Essen trade fair, Germany, David Austin’s new varieties Effie, Ella and Eugenie are now in production at Alexandra Farms to use in bridal and other luxury flower arrangements. Available since spring 2019 many florists are very excited about the new roses. Effie is a beautiful buttery […]
